Abstract

In the history of Bashkir literature, the names of writers writing in Russian are known. These are M. Gafurov, R. Khakimov, A. Sharipov, R. Bikmukhametov, Y. Mustafin, R. Akhmedov, Y. Ilyasova, G. Shafikov, D. Daminov, R. Maksutov, S. Sadykov, and others. Many of them, by the will of fate, finding themselves far from their native land, living outside the republic, have lost the opportunity to communicate and write in their native Bashkir language. However, they wrote their works about their people, for their people, described their native nature: the Ural-Tau mountain, rivers and lakes, etc. One of these writers who wrote in Russian was Talkha Genatulin. The article examines the work of the famous Bashkir and Russian front-line writer Talkha Yumabaevich Genatullin (signed as Anatoly Genatulin) (1925–2019), whose 100th anniversary is celebrated today by the entire public, scientific, and literary communities of the Republic of Bashkortostan. Genatulin was one of the few Bashkir writers who wrote in Russian. However, he wrote about the Bashkirs; he glorified the heroism of the Bashkir warrior; he was inspired by the natural beauty of his small homeland and the spurs of the Ural Mountains.
